    Wee tip on pasta, cook, cool and reheated, it has a far lower GI rating than freshly cooked because it creates resistant starch. See Michael Mosley and Diabetes UK.

    Sounds pretty good , I live on my own and don't think I do as well. Sometimes I make a big batch of veggie soup including lentils ( red don't need to be soaked) or tinned beans and keeps for 4 or so days. For quick meals/ snacks sometimes have scrambled egg on toast, moved away from beans on toast as think baked beans are quite processed. Go for wholemeal pasta and brown rice but some white rice as quicker .

    When I was working I did a huge pan of veggie soup and stuff got added during the week. That was tasty and healthy.

    I'd also use a weekend morning to batch bake with something interesting on the radio, then I'd have good fresh meals ready from the freezer.
    Stuffed marrow for one I used to make in rings, cutting it across and freeze those, freeze some sauce as well. Its not as good as fresh but my body sighed with relief when I ate that of an evening.

    I always took Saturday mornings as my time out from healthy and had doughnuts with my coffee after shopping and something tasty for lunch.
    A chocolate as desert after a healthy meal.
    I find more incentive to cook and eat better if there is a little naughty treat now and then.
